Other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Mali
Mali: Other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ell was 962,080 1000 SLC in 2024. ▲ Rising
Other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Mali, 1961–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 SLC.
Analysis
In 2024, other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Mali stood at 962,080 1000 SLC.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.1% on the previous year and up 8.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, other nuts (excluding wild edible nuts and groundnuts), in shell in Mali peaked at 1.08 million 1000 SLC in 2001 and was at its lowest, 412,462 1000 SLC, in 1991.
That places Mali 17th out of 45 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
